By Mohammed Nasir Shuaibu (Bauchi correspondent)
Bauchi State Governor, Senator Bala Mohammed, has described the Director General of the National Broadcasting Commission (NBC), Alhaji Balarabe Shehu Ilelah, as one of the few indigenes of the state that are adequately representing the state well and making it proud in the eyes of the nation and the global community.
Governor Mohammed gave the recommendations while receiving the DG at the Government House in Bauchi.
The governor said despite political party differences, Balarabe Shehu Ilelah is maintaining cordial relationships with his administration and supporting all initiatives geared towards the development of the state.
The former FCT minister, however, used the medium to called on others heading various Ministries, Departments and Agencies at the federal level to emulate the DG for the overall interest of the state and the country as a whole.
On his part, the Director General NBC who said he was at the Government House to felicitate with the Governor on the occasion of the Eid-El Fitr Celebration, maintained that he placed the interest of the state above politics.
He also applauded the governor for what he described as the huge investment made in critical aspects of health, education, agriculture and infrastructure, in both rural and urban areas.
Governor Bala Mohammed, during the Sallah festival, received high-profile individuals, groups and organizations. NNL.
